This canned chicken is prepared from whole chickens processed under controlled conditions, with a minimum chicken content of 50% by weight in each can. The product is cooked in broth or brine, available in chunks, shredded, or pulled forms to suit diverse culinary uses. Cans are sealed for extended shelf life, targeting food service operators, military rations, and retail distribution channels.
The raw material is sourced from farm-raised chickens, with no antibiotics used in rearing, aligning with common industry practices for food-grade poultry. A typical protein content for cooked chicken meat is 25-30% by wet weight, with fat content often below 5% in lean cuts. Standard moisture content for canned chicken ranges between 70-75%, preserving texture and flavour during storage. The product adheres to food safety protocols, with HALAL certification typical for Brazilian poultry exports.
Canned chicken serves as a versatile protein source for soups, salads, sandwiches, and ready meals in commercial kitchens and institutional catering. Buyers include supermarkets, food manufacturers, and relief agencies requiring long-life protein provision. Trade terms commonly used for Brazilian poultry exports include FOB and CIF, with packaging options ranging from 200g to 3kg cans. Before ordering, verify the supplier’s current certifications, including HALAL status and any additional food safety accreditations required by your market. Request a certificate of analysis for the specific batch to confirm protein, fat, and moisture content, as these can vary by production run. Check that the canned chicken meets your country’s import regulations for poultry products, including any labelling or health certificate requirements.
Confirm logistics details such as lead time, which can vary based on production schedules and shipping availability from Brazil. Typical incoterms for poultry exports include FOB or CIF, so clarify who bears the cost of freight and insurance. Packaging specifications, such as can dimensions and pallet configuration, should be reviewed to ensure they align with your storage and handling capabilities.
Quality checks should include visual inspection for can integrity and labelling accuracy upon receipt. For food service use, consider arranging a third-party inspection to verify product consistency and compliance with your specifications. Request documentation such as the commercial invoice, packing list, and bill of lading to ensure all trade and customs requirements are met.
